Characteristics:
- Made of High-Strength Material: Elevator expansion bolts are typically crafted from high-strength steel or other durable metals, ensuring their ability to withstand continuous stress and vibrations during elevator operation.
- Unique Expansion Design: The bolts expand when tightened, fitting securely into the mounting hole and providing stable support.
- Precise Manufacturing Standards: Elevator expansion bolts adhere to international safety standards and regulations, guaranteeing their quality and reliability.
Advantages:
- High Safety: Thanks to the use of high-strength materials and unique design, elevator expansion bolts offer exceptional safety performance, ensuring the stable operation of the elevator system.
- Strong Stability: The expansion characteristic of the bolts allows them to fit tightly into the mounting hole, effectively preventing loosening and detachment, thus ensuring firm connections between various elevator components.
- Wide Applicability: Elevator expansion bolts are versatile and can be used in different types of elevator installation and maintenance scenarios.
Application Scenarios:
- Elevator Installation: During the initial installation of elevators, expansion bolts are used to secure guide rails, machine rooms, and other crucial components, ensuring the overall stability and safety of the elevator system.
- Elevator Maintenance: In the daily maintenance and repair of elevators, expansion bolts may need to be replaced or tightened to ensure the normal operation and safety performance of the elevator.
- High-Rise Buildings: In high-rise buildings, elevator expansion bolts endure greater stress and vibrations, making their importance even more prominent. In these buildings, expansion bolts are widely used at various critical connection points of the elevator system.
